How much do diesel engineer jobs pay per hour?

As of Aug 30, 2026, the average hourly pay for diesel engineer in New Mexico is $38.52,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$31.68 and $43.80 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is a diesel engineer?

Diesel Engineers are specialized professionals who design, maintain, repair, and oversee diesel engines and related systems. They work with a variety of diesel-powered equipment, such as trucks, buses, ships, generators, and heavy machinery. Their responsibilities typically include diagnosing engine problems, performing routine maintenance, ensuring compliance with safety standards, and sometimes upgrading engine systems for better efficiency. Diesel Engineers may work in industries like transportation, construction, agriculture, or energy, and often need strong mechanical skills and knowledge of diesel engine technology.

What does a diesel engineer do?

The duties of a diesel engineer or mechanic are to inspect, maintain, and repair diesel engines. They perform diagnostics on engines and inspect the parts and system machinery to determine what service is required on the vehicle. A diesel engineer regularly utilizes diagnostic equipment and other tools, and they should have an in-depth knowledge of the diesel electrical system. Customer service skills are also important when describing a repair to a customer.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a diesel engineer,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Diesel Engineer, you need strong mechanical aptitude, knowledge of diesel engine systems, and typically a degree or diploma in mechanical or automotive engineering. Familiarity with diagnostic tools, engine management software, and industry certifications such as ASE Diesel Certification are often required. Problem-solving ability, attention to detail, and effective communication are standout soft skills in this role. These skills ensure accurate diagnostics, efficient repairs, and reliable engine performance in various industrial and transportation settings.

What are some typical challenges diesel engineers face when working on large-scale projects?

Diesel Engineers working on large-scale projects often encounter challenges such as coordinating with multidisciplinary teams, troubleshooting complex engine issues under tight deadlines, and ensuring compliance with strict environmental and safety regulations. Effective communication and adaptability are crucial, as project requirements may change and unexpected technical problems can arise. Additionally, staying up-to-date with advancements in diesel technology and emission standards is essential for success in this dynamic field.

What is the difference between Diesel Engineer vs Mechanical Engineer?

AspectDiesel EngineerMechanical Engineer
CertificationsRelevant certifications in diesel systems, such as ASE or manufacturer-specific trainingEngineering degrees, often a Bachelor's in Mechanical Engineering
Work EnvironmentWorkshops, repair facilities, and on-site at transportation or industrial companiesDesign offices, manufacturing plants, or research labs
Industry UsageTransportation, maritime, and industrial sectors focusing on diesel enginesBroad industry applications including automotive, aerospace, manufacturing, and energy

Diesel Engineers specialize in maintaining and repairing diesel engines, often requiring specific certifications and working in hands-on environments. Mechanical Engineers have a broader scope, focusing on design, analysis, and development across various engineering fields. While both roles require engineering knowledge, Diesel Engineers focus more on practical maintenance within specific industries, whereas Mechanical Engineers are involved in design and innovation across multiple sectors.

How much do diesel engineers get paid?

Diesel engineers typically earn a median annual salary of around $50,000 to $70,000, depending on experience, location, and certifications. Skilled diesel engineers with specialized knowledge of engines and maintenance procedures can earn higher wages, especially in industrial or transportation sectors.

About the Role:

This position is responsible for the repair and maintenance of fleet vehicles operated by R. Marely, LLC. This person will be working out of our Roswell, NM location. This includes preventive maintenance, minor and major repairs of Semi Tractor trucks, Trailers, construction equipment and other types of equipment operated by the company. This position is a Monday-Friday shift with some on-call and/or weekend work required.


Essential Duties and Responsibilities:

  • Ensure that all repairs and maintenance services are completed promptly and efficiently, focusing on quality service.
  • Routinely determine what parts and tools will be needed to complete the repairs.
  • Maintain accurate records of all service and repair orders, including customer information, asset information, and work performed.
  • Develop and maintain positive relationships with co-workers.
  • Ensure compliance with safety and environmental regulations and maintain a clean and organized work environment.
  • Assisting other mechanics as requested and qualified with identifying and correcting problems in equipment on which they are working.
  • Diagnosing, personally and/or with the assistance of the Shop Foreman or other mechanics.
  • Working safely at all times; complying with all OSHA or other city, county, state, or federal regulations when working and for reporting in case of any on job injury; following company safety policies and procedures.
  • Other duties and special projects as assigned or required.



Requirements:

  • High School Diploma or GED, with continuing education in mechanics or engineering. 
  • Diesel Mechanical or Technician degrees, diplomas or certifications are strongly preferred.
  • At least Five years of experience in the automotive and/or truck maintenance and repair field
  • Personal skills must include mechanical ability, analytical thinking, and work organization.
  • This individual must have the ability to prioritize the work to be done and focus on it, possess a high sense of urgency, to be thorough with the work being done, to offer his/her best knowledge of the situation to be used, project integrity and credibility to the company.
  • Strong knowledge of heavy-duty diesel applications, computer diagnostics, Air brake systems, Hydraulics and Electrical Systems.
  • Class A CDL a plus
